About the Property
Make yourself at home in one of the 2 individually decorated guestrooms, featuring kitchens with full-sized refrigerators/freezers and ovens. Your memory foam bed comes with premium bedding. 55-inch Smart televisions with premium TV channels provide entertainment, while complimentary wireless internet access keeps you connected. Conveniences include desks and separate sitting areas, as well as phones with free local calls.
